What is the height of a cylinder when only given the volume and radius?

Since the formula for the volume of a cylinder is PI time the radius squared times the height we can calculate the height from the other two values. The height is the volume divide by PI times the radius squared.


How do you find the height of a sphere when you have the volume?

Vol = 4/3*pi*r3 so given the volume, you can calculate the radius. Height of sphere = 2*radius.

How do you find radius of cone when given volume and height?

The volume of a cone is 1/3 pi times the radius squared times the height. When given the volume and height divide both sides by the height. Volume divided by height is equal to 1/3 times pi times the radius squared. Now divide both sides by 1/3 pi. This will leave you with the radius squared. Take the square root of both sides and you will get the radius.


What is the volume of a hemisphere?

The volume of a hemisphere is given by the formula 4 x pi x r3/6, where r is the radius and pi is approximately 3.1416

What is the volume of a cylinder with a radius of 4 cm?

The volume of a cylinder, V, is given by the formula:V = pi*r^2*h where r is the radius and h is the height of the cylinder. It is necessary to know both the radius and the height before you can determine the volume.
